House Concurrent Resolution 0014 (HCR0014) serves to congratulate Dylan Maxwell, a senior student-athlete from East Central High School, for earning the IHSAA 2023 Football State Mental Attitude Award. This prestigious recognition highlights his exceptional performance not only in athletics but also in academics and community service. Dylan displayed remarkable achievements during the football season, accumulating notable statistics and excelling as a leader in various sports, which led to his nomination for this award.
